Engaging in political discourse in today’s charged environment can feel daunting. Here’s how you can navigate these conversations:

Know Your Facts

Before stepping into a political discussion, ensure you’re well-informed about the issues at hand. Misinformation can be a significant barrier to productive conversations. Utilize reputable sources to stay updated:

  • Visit government websites for official statistics and data
  • Consult academic journals for in-depth analysis and research
  • Follow trusted news outlets

Listen Actively

One of the most effective ways to de-escalate tensions is to show that you’re listening. This means:

  • Giving the other person your full attention
  • Paraphrasing their points to confirm your understanding
  • Recognizing and respecting differing viewpoints

Active listening can transform adversarial discussions into collaborative dialogues.

Use Respectful Language

Respectful language helps maintain a cordial environment even when opinions differ. Avoid:

  • Name-calling
  • Inflammatory language
  • Public shaming or personal attacks

Instead, practice empathy. Remember, the goal is understanding, not winning.
